Elizabeth Taylor’s legacy as one of the most glamorous actresses in Hollywood history remains as steadfast as when she was still with us. You can’t even hear her name without your mind conjuring images of her beauty, class, and grace — both onscreen and off. While there are several admirable areas of the late actress’s life worth celebrating, we are particularly drawn to her lifelong love for animals. 

We aren’t just talking about the four-legged co-stars she shared the screen with often, including her two big breaks as a teen: the pooch from Lassie Come Home and horse from National Velvet. Liz’s love of animals began long before that while being raised on her family’s farm in the English countryside. “I think I prefer animals to people,” she once said in one of her most famous quotes. “And I was lucky — my first leading men were dogs and horses.” Take a look at the heartwarming photos of young Elizabeth Taylor and her animal friends below to remember the beautiful connection she had with creatures big and small.
